What if TVA had completed Bellefonte, Phipps Bend, Yellow Creek and Hartsville Nuclear plants back in the 70s and 80s?

I doubt we would be having schools close to meet the demand of electricity.

As we now have a president with a vision of leading the world in technology, AI and industry, Tennessee and the TVA would have been key players as all three of President Trump’s ambitions demand energy.

It’s my hope that TVA, with their experience and expertise, is preparing to address this and hopefully with a better execution of construction and a standardization of plants to make construction, components and operations more efficient.

We’ve got all the parts here in Tennessee and with the DOE at Oak Ridge paired up with TVA what would be the possibilities?
